Cu-exchanged zeolites possess active sites that are able to cleave the C–H bond of methane at temperatures ≤200 °C, enabling its selective partial oxidation methanol. Herein we explore this process over Cu-SSZ-13 materials. We combine activity tests and X-ray absorption spectroscopy (XAS) thoroughly investigate influence reaction parameters material elemental composition on productivity Cu speciation during key steps. find CuII moieties responsible for conversion formed in presence O2 high temperature together with prolonged activation time increases population such sites. evidence a linear correlation between reducibility materials their methanol productivity. By optimizing conditions composition, reach as 0.2 mol CH3OH/mol (125 μmol/g), highest value reported date Cu-SSZ-13. Our results clearly demonstrate populations 2Al Z2CuII 6r, favored low values both Si:Al Cu:Al ratios, inhibit performance by being inactive conversion. Z[CuIIOH] complexes, although shown be inactive, identified precursors methane-converting critical examination catalytic spectroscopic evidence, propose different possible routes active-site formation.

In the past decade or so, small-pore zeolites have received greater attention than large- and medium-pore molecular sieves that historically dominated literature. This is primarily due to commercialization of two major catalytic processes, NOx exhaust removal methanol conversion light olefins, take advantage properties these materials with smaller apertures. Small-pore possess pores are constructed eight tetrahedral atoms (Si4+ Al3+), each time linked by a shared oxygen These eight-member ring (8MR) provide small molecules access intracrystalline void space, e.g., during car cleaning (NOx removal) en route its into while restricting larger molecule entrance departure critical overall catalyst performance. total, there forty-four structurally different zeolites. Forty-one can be synthesized, first synthetic zeolite (KFI, 1948) was in fact material. A radical route from methane to methanol The conversion of into chemicals usually proceeds through high-temperature routes that first form more reactive carbon monoxide and hydrogen. Agarwal et al. report a low-temperature (50°C) in aqueous hydrogen peroxide (H 2 O ) for oxidizing high yield (92%). They used colloidal gold-palladium nanoparticles as catalyst. primary oxidant was ; isotopic labeling showed H activated methyl radicals, which subsequently incorporated .
